Cast iron is a type of iron that has been alloyed with carbon and other elements to create a material that is strong, durable, and resistant to corrosion. It is used in a variety of applications, from automotive and industrial components to cookware and decorative items. Cast iron is produced by melting iron ore in a furnace and then pouring it into a mold. The molten iron is then cooled and solidified, forming a cast iron product. Cast iron is a popular material for many applications due to its strength and durability. It is often used in the construction of bridges, buildings, and other structures, as well as in the production of machinery and tools. It is also used in the production of cookware, such as skillets and Dutch ovens, as well as decorative items, such as door knockers and garden sculptures.
